For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 84 students in Lisbon, NH.
The top-ranked public high school in Lisbon, NH is Lisbon Regional School (High).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Lisbon, NH public high school have an average math proficiency score of 50% (versus the New Hampshire public high school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 30% (versus the 62% statewide average). High schools in Lisbon have an average ranking of 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of New Hampshire public high schools.
Lisbon, NH public high school have a Graduation Rate of 80%, which is less than the New Hampshire average of 88%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Lisbon Regional School (High), with ≥80%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in New Hampshire or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 6%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the New Hampshire public high school average of 18% (majority Hispanic).
